Is 0.8 waist to hip ratio good?
Good (below 0.80) Generally if you have a ratio of 0.75 to 0.8 you are at low risk of weight-related disease but it is important to maintain your shape with a healthy diet and regular activity. The longer you can prevent central fat deposition, the longer and healthier your life will be.

What do you mean by waist hip ratio explain with one suitable example class 11?
The waist–hip ratio or waist-to-hip ratio (WHR) is the dimensionless ratio of the circumference of the waist to that of the hips. This is calculated as waist measurement divided by hip measurement (W⁄H). For example, a person with a 30″ (76 cm) waist and 38″ (97 cm) hips has a waist–hip ratio of about 0.78.
What is weight to hip ratio?
Unlike your body mass index (BMI), which calculates the ratio of your weight to your height, WHR measures the ratio of your waist circumference to your hip circumference. It determines how much fat is stored on your waist, hips, and buttocks. Not all excess weight is the same when it comes to your health risks.

What is the best waist to hip ratio?
In women, the ratio should be 0.8 or less, and in men, it should be 1.0 or less. (This means that in women the waist should be narrower than the hips, and in men, the waist should be narrower or the same as the hips.) The waist-to-hip ratio is helpful because in smaller people waist circumference alone may underestimate risk.
How do you calculate waist to hip ratio?
Waist to hip ratio is calculated by measuring the circumference of an individual’s waist and dividing it by the circumference of the individual’s hips. To measure the waist, you will need a tape measure or some sort of measuring device. While standing in a relaxed position, take the waist measurement at the smallest portion of the natural waist.
How to measure hips and waist ratio?
To measure it yourself: Stand up straight and breathe out. Use a tape measure to check the distance around the smallest part of your waist, just above your belly button. Then measure the distance around the largest part of your hips – the widest part of your buttocks. Calculate your WHR by dividing your waist circumference by your hip circumference.
What should my waist measure?
Women should aim for a waist measurement below 35 inches, and men below 40 inches. A waist measurement of 35 or more in women and 40 or more in men has been linked to increased risk for type 2 diabetes, high cholesterol, high blood pressure and cardiovascular disease.
